Woking FC defeated Wrexham 2-0 at Kingfield.
What happened?
The Cards came into the clash on a high but didn't really get going in the first half. Wrexham looked the most likely to score, with Michael Poke making a terrific save to deny John Rooney from a free-kick.
Key moments
Cards dominated the possession in the second half, mounting some dangerous attacks. Jake Caprice swung in one or two dangerous crosses, and Delano Sam-Yorke headed one centre wide at the near post.
Turning point
Woking made it count with a cracking goal from Fabio Saraiva, who smashed in from the edge of the box in the 81st minute. A mazy run from Dennon Lewis ended with Gozi Ugwu firing goalwards, and Chike Kandi volleyed in to round off a rousing win.
